Campbell Soup Company announced today (29 June) that its directors have elected retired Tetra Pak CEO Nick Shreiber to join the board, effective 1 July.

Shreiber served as president and CEO of food packaging company Tetra Pak from 2000 to 2005. Prior to Tetra Pak, Shreiber was a partner at McKinsey & Company, with responsibility for major industrial and service sector clients in Europe and Latin America.


“Nick’s global experience and knowledge of the food and packaging industries will complement our board,” said Campbell chairman Harvey Golub.


“His experience in Russia and throughout Europe will be especially beneficial to Campbell’s international expansion plans. We look forward to adding another accomplished business leader to our board.”


Shreiber succeeds Philip Lippincott, who retired from the board in November 2008. With Shreiber’s election, the Campbell board will consist of 16 members, 15 of whom will be independent.
